Analyzing Peg Placement and Descent Paths

The arrangement of pegs is paramount to the gameplay experience in plinko. They disrupt the direct trajectory of the disc, introducing elements of stochasticity into the descent. However, the placement isn’t uniformly random. Designers often strategically position pegs to influence the probability distribution of the final outcome. A densely packed section, for instance, tends to diffuse the disc’s path, increasing the likelihood of it veering towards the edges. Conversely, sparsely populated areas enable a more focused and directed descent. Careful attention toward this balance is crucial for cultivating a thrilling and balanced player engagement.

The Influence of Board Width and Angle

The dimensions of the plinko board—its width and the angle of inclination—subtly, yet significantly, impact the potential outcomes. A wider board offers a broader spectrum of possible landing zones, effectively diminishing the concentration of probability towards any single slot. A steeper slope however, risks a faster, more unpredictable fall, often overpowering subtle nudge effects caused by the rebounding of pegs during descent. The overall architectural composition plays a huge role in the distribution pattern that is experienced.
